Veri.Me provides a secure, researcher-owned and directed digital identity that enables verified access without exposing personal data.  

Veri.Me is a global digital identity verification service for researchers that can be directly integrated into existing systems for access to research data and resources. It eliminates the need for research systems to collect and store sensitive personal information (PII) while also providing assurance that system access is limited to identity-verified users.

Veri.Me uses cryptographic techniques like zero-knowledge proofs for high-fidelity identity verification assurance without the need for entities to see original documents. Account access theft, tracking, and surveillance will be more difficult because authentication and identity information is no longer contained in large, centrally-owned and managed databases.

Veri.Me extends reputation-based systems like ORCID by providing a public key that verifies the identity and personhood of an account holder. It removes the need for universities and governments to collect and store sensitive identity documents.

In addition to these tangible benefits to institutions, we expect a significant benefit to researchers themselves in owning and managing the sharing of their verified digital identity.

Who We Are

The Veri.Me founding team is well-established in the research community, with decades of global experience with start-ups to Fortune 100 companies in research infrastructure, technical platforms, data privacy, and cryptographic security

Laura Paglione, MBA

Co-Founder

Laura brings expertise in software development, global research infrastructure, and federated identity management. As ORCID’s founding Technical Director, Laura launched and directed the member and user offerings for the platform that grew to serve over 5 million users within its first six years. In positions at the Kauffman Foundation, Ford Motor Company and Avid Technology, she created and executed business and technical launch plans for new ventures. Laura has an MBA from the MIT Sloan School of Management.

Laure Haak, PhD

Co-Founder

Laure brings expertise in product strategy, partnerships, governance, and start-up operations along with a global network through her work at Thomson Reuters and as the founding Executive Director of ORCID and principal of the Mighty Red Barn consultancy. Laure has a PhD in Neurosciences from Stanford University and was a postdoctoral scholar at the US National Institutes of Health.

Shady El Damaty, PhD

Advisor and Partner

Shady is founder of OpSci, CEO of Holonym, and principal in the human.tech project, a decentralized identity protocol with 2m+ users and 35.4m credentials created, on which we plan to build our code base. Shady has a PhD in Neuroscience from Georgetown University.

Commitment to Open Science

  • Who We Serve

    Veri.Me is an important open science tool that enables researcher mobility and broad participation. Our primary stakeholders are researchers.

  • Our Governance

    Veri.Me is organized as a public benefit corporation governed by researcher-users. Users control their Veri.Me accounts, and can both verify identity and generate a public key, accessible by API, all while maintaining PII privacy.

  • Our Business Model

    Our business model is based on API fees, a proportion of which will be redistributed to users.

  • Our Technology

    We leverage the proven and open source Zeronym technology as Veri.Me's foundation, and in kind, make our work available under an MIT Open Source license.
